Я уже некоторое время работаю с ruby / rails и недавно перешел на PHP Laravel для моей новой работы. В рельсах, когда я запускал свой сервер, он показывал мне очень полезные вещи, такие как: какой маршрут попадает, какие запросы выполнялись для этого контроллера и так далее.
В Laravel, когда я запускаю сервер, все говорит
Laravel development server started: <http://127.0.0.1:8000>
и он просто сидит там.
Есть ли какой-то пакет композитора или что-то, о чем я не знаю, что я должен включить в конфигурации, чтобы показывать какую-то соответствующую информацию, когда маршруты попадают ???
Я искал "живой журнал laravel" и наткнулся на этот пакет https://packagist.org/packages/mic/log-like-rails Но я не могу его правильно установить.
Фреймворк Laravel 5.6.22 PHP 7.1.18-1 + ubuntu16.04.1 + deb.sury.org + 1
Я не уверен, что вы хотите, но вы можете запустить php -S localhost:8000 -t public. Здесь используется тот же встроенный веб-сервер PHP, что и artisan serve, но таким образом каждый URL-адрес, который вы нажимаете, отображается в stdout, т.е. в вашем терминале
php -S localhost:8000 -t public - действительно хороший шаг вперед, спасибо. Я надеялся на что-то большее, например, на пакет или какую-то скрытую функцию разработчика, которую мне нужно было включить, но после вчерашнего двухчасового исследования я не думаю, что нет ничего из того, что я ищу. Еще раз спасибо за все ответы.






Этот пакет очень старый и предназначен для Laravel 4.2, поэтому неудивительно, что вы не можете установить его на 5.6. Панель отладки Laravel содержит много полезной информации и не ограничивается использованием
artisan serve, поскольку многие люди запускают hometead, wamp / xampp / laragon или другую среду разработки.